Most CRM adoption programs work by blocking people
Required fields. Validation rules. A manager chasing the reps who skipped them. It works right up until people start routing around the system entirely, and then you’ve got worse data than when you started plus a team that resents the tool.
Carrot over stick is the opposite bet
Supered puts the guidance where the rep already is, inside the CRM, at the moment they need it. That made it possible to design for the correct path also being the fastest path. Clean data stopped being something to enforce and became a side effect of people doing their job the easy way.
That’s what got adoption across four teams instead of one: sales, customer success, onboarding, and support. Errors dropped, and not one step got added to the sales workflow to make it happen.
